I'm having trouble with my S3 and Verizon's messaging app. I can receive the texts just fine through the watch, but cannot reply? When I hit reply it prompts an automatic notification that says "See Phone".

I haven't had any issue receiving or replying to texts from the watch with Textra, Google Messages or the stock messaging app, just this one.

Anyone seen this issue or have a fix?

The Messages+ app simply doesn't work with the watch so there's no fix to it.

I use the Messages+ app on my phone (S8+), but just have notifications from the stock messaging app pushed to the watch with notifications from Messages+ turned off for the watch. From there I can just use the messaging app on the watch to reply or whatever. It works fine that way.

On your phone, go into the Samsung Gear app -> Settings -> Notifications -> Manage Notifications. Make sure that notifications for "Messages" is turned ON and "Message+" is turned OFF. In this configuration, you can use Message+ (Verizon) on your phone and Message (Samsung) on the watch. The only problem I am currently facing is that I get my delivery/read receipts from Message+ sent to the watch as incoming SMS notifications..... Had to turn off delivery/read receipts until I find a solution.
